knock
-
- An abrupt rapping sound, as from an impact of a hard object against wood.
- A sharp impact.
- A criticism.
- A blow or setback.
- Preignition, a type of abnormal combustion occurring in spark ignition engines caused by self-ignition; also, the characteristic knocking sound associated with it.
- A batsman's innings.
- Synonym of hunger knock
